Vanguard Balanced Index Fund Admiral Shares (VBIAX) is a hybrid index fund that maintains an allocation of roughly 60% stocks and 40% bonds. Specifically, it tracks two indexes, one for U.S. equities and one for taxable U.S. bonds. Apr 28, 2023 · Vanguard Balanced Index Fund seeks capital appreciation, current income, and long-term growth of income by tracking the investment performance of a balanced benchmark, with 60% of assets invested in the broad U.S. stock market and 40% of assets held in the investment-grade U.S. bond market. If your balance is higher, then multiplying by another factor and then multiplying by number of years, you may decide the additional cost is not worth it.Sep 7, 2023 · VBIAX is the Vanguard Balanced Index Fund and it is exactly equivalent to 60% in Total Stock and 40% in Total Bond, rebalanced continuously. It is, in fact, an example of a Bogleheads' three-fund portfolio in which the overall stock/bond allocation is 60/40 and the stock allocation is 100% US. Pillar 2.
